The city of Zaun is a place where both magic and science have gone awry. The unchecked nature of experimentation has taken its toll on the city. However, Zaun's lenient restrictions allow their researchers and inventors the leeway to push the bounds of science at an accelerated rate, for better or worse. It was under these conditions that a team of doctoral students from Zaun's College of Techmaturgy made a breakthrough in the field of intelligent steam automation. Their creation, the steam golem Blitzcrank, was developed to exercise judgment on-the-fly in order to assist with Zaun's hazardous waste reclamation process, since so often the conditions did not allow for human supervision. However, he soon began exhibiting unforeseen behaviors.

Over time, the scientists were able to identify a demonstrated learning process, and Blitzcrank fast became a celebrity. As is sadly often the case though, credit for the golem's creation was scooped up by another - Professor Stanwick Pididly - though most now know the truth. In the wake of the ensuing legal maelstrom, it became evident that neither party truly had the steam golem's best interests at heart, and Blitzcrank humbly petitioned for personal autonomy. Backed by overwhelming support from the public, it took the liberal Council of Zaun only a few weeks to declare Blitzcrank a fully-independent, sentient entity. A unique being, the golem left Zaun, distressed by the controversy and feeling there was no place he could fit in. His travels led him to the one location in Valoran where unique beings have a place - the League of Legends. Fortunately, he was easily able to adapt his design to suit the rigors he would face on the Fields of Justice.

Though Blitzcrank may batter anything that stands in his way, he really has a heart of gold... encased in a framework of iron... in a carapace of steel.

Abilities and Their Sequence


Mana Barrier: This passive makes Blitzcrank tanky by stacking items that provide mana pool.
Rocket Grab(Q): This is Blitzcrank's signature spell and what makes him so special. One of the most funny to use abilities that also helps distinguish good players. It is a skillshot that grabs the first enemy hit within 1000 range and drags him to Blitzcrank.
Overdrive(W): This spell is Blitzcrank's build in steroid that significantly boosts his speed and attack speed.
Power Fist(E): This spell is a knock-up CC with a low cooldown, giving Blitzcrank a lot of single target control.
Static Field(R): This is his ultimate, which has both a passive feature and an active one! This, along with Q and E abilities, is the 3rd way Blitzcrank can interrupt a channeling spell (like Nunu's Absolute Zero), because it silences the enemies in 600 range AOE for 0,5 sec!





As far as skill sequense is concerned, I have a different route for every role.

Support

Ability Sequence
1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18

When supporting I max out Rocket Grab first, mainly, because every rank reduces its cooldown, so I can use it more often to opt for a kill and it does 300 damage by level 9 that helps a lot. In addition, it has come to my attention that I nearly never have the chance to Power Fist twice due to the small duration of the 2v2 fights, when, either the opponent caught manages to escape, with Flash and the help of his support, or he dies to the combined damage output of Blitz and his Ad carry. Second I max Power Fist for cooldown and last Overdrive. I take Static Field immediately when available.

AD

Ability Sequence
1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18

When I am top as Ad, I prefer to max out Power Fist first, because I really need that CC on low cd to farm, harass and bully my opponent. Top laners, being tanky, tend to engage in longer lasting battles, where Power Fist can be used twice or more. Then I max Overdrive for movement speed and attack speed and I leave Rocket Grab for last as its range is equal at all levels. Static Field is picked always at levels 6, 11 and 16!


AP

Ability Sequence
1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18

In Ap build I max out Rocket Grab first again, due to the fact that it is my main source of damage paired with Static Field. Then I focus on Power Fist for the reduction of its cooldown per rank and I leave Overdrive for last. Static Field ranked when available as always.



Jungle

Ability Sequence
1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18

With Blitz in da jungle I use Power Fist at level 1,then Overdrive at level 2 and Rocket Grab at level 3, so I can gank. Then I take 1 more point in Overdrive for the movement speed and attack speed to help me jungle faster and gank more often. Between Power Fist and Rocket Grab, I then focus on Power Fist for the reduction in cooldown per rank. Static Field at levels 6, 11 and 16 again and always :P

Summoner Spells



In all 4 builds I use Flash, even though it's nerfed, because I fancy the Flash-then- Rocket Grab technique to catch a fleeing opponent or Flash- Power Fist to initiate. Also Blitzcrank can escape easily if he uses that meager 400 range Flash and Overdrive away like crazy.

So, together with Flash, I use: Other summoner spells:
  • Teleport: I maybe use this as AD when solo-ing top. It gives you the advantage of a quick dragon, a quick gank, teleporting to save an ally or simply getting back to your lane faster.
  • Ghost: I really don't like this on Blitz, mainly because he has a movement speed buff of his own and Flash helps him so much more.(wall jump etc.)
  • Heal: A good spell, nowadays, that can be used instead of Flash or Clairvoyance when supporting. It's useful to other roles as well. I just don't use it often.
  • Clarity: It used to be a choice for some reason, but I never used it or appreciated it. Mana regen and mana pool is sufficient and other summoner spells are just more useful.
  • Cleanse: Good spell overall, but I would choose it for a carry that needs to be free from hard CC in order to deal more damage or simply live. If you get focused by CC then it is probably a good thing cause every CC on Blitz is -1 CC for your Carries! You are tanky enough to endure even a Chain-CC-combo.
  • Surge: I don't know much about this spell, haven't even tested it, so I will just say that I never use it and I can't find a reason why I should. I don't need attack speed or ablity power and/or other choices offer a far better advantage.
  • Promote, Revive: Bla Bla Bla... I build tanky so I don't usually or easily die and pushing with a "super catapult" is not that useful in any lane that doesn't want to get ganked.

You made it to my favorite build of all!The AD one!

When I play AD bruiser Blitzcrank solo top, I start with Boots of Speed and a 3 Health Potions. I immediately build a Sheen for the extra burst every time I Power Fist. Tear of the Goddess and cooldown reduction come next with Glacial Shroud. Then I upgrade to tier 2 boots and Frozen Heart. Next I finish Manamune and Trinity Force, followed with a Banshee's Veil and an Atma's Impaler. Atma's provides 45 bonus AD, 45 armor and 18 critical strike chance at a low price. So it is viable and gold efficient if you are sitting on top of 3000 hp or more. With this build you have a very strong bruiser with high resist and a big health pool in addition to a huge shield.

So here you are at Blitzcrank's most underplayed side, which is a lot of fun btw.

When playing AP and solo top, I (again) start with Boots of Speed and 3 Health Potions. I build first a Catalyst the Protector followed by a Sheen which is good for early Power Fist damage and will build into a Lich Bane later on. I finish Rod of Ages, buy tier 2 boots and then build a Deathfire Grasp.
After the Lich Bane, I build defensively and buy a Guardian Angel. Last, I choose Rabadon's Deathcap for the extra ap.

With this build I can pretty much one-shot the AP carry, the Ad carry or the (poor) support, or even cripple severely the (assuming)tanky solo top or Jungler. This means that, with the help of my team, anyone that gets Rocket Grabbed is instantly-killed even if Deathfire Grasp is on cd.

Minion waves are obliterated with Static Field so you can push very very fast. Generally if you can survive the laning phase and be a little farmed, then you are a true asset to your team. The only problem is focus fire. In a teamfight, once you blow your ultimate Static Field and use Rocket Grab, your only source of damage is Lich Bane proc and Power Fist attack. You should always try to catch an opponent off-guard to gain an advantage (preferrably a Carry).A well-aimed Rocket Grab wins games.

Although Blitzcrank is not the best of junglers, he can perform well, especially now that jungle has been made so easy. In the new jungle, successful ganking is vital and Blitz has one or two tricks to pull off a good gank.
My starting items were Cloth Armor and 5 Health Potions, but now I run Regrowth Pendant into a Philosopher's Stone. Choose whichever suits you best. By the time you reach level 3 you can start ganking or even at 2 if the circumstances favor it.

I propose this jungle route:
  • Blue with the leash of a teammate where I use smite. (Help is appreciated but not necessary)
  • Wolves
  • Wraiths
  • Double Golems (smite)
  • Gank
  • Teleport Base
  • Ancient Golem (red buff)
  • Gank (mid or bot)
  • Continue ganking and farming and follow the build

Alternatively, you can level up Rocket Grab at level 2 for a gank after wolves, and then continue to wraiths and so on. In order to make that choice look at the lanes. Your opponents. Your allies and their skills. Then make your decision. For example: Your ally mid is Annie, so she can prepare a stun and even use Ignite (usually). She sounds dangerous... So it is a good choice to go for an early gank and try to "burn" the defensive summoner spell of the opponent ( Flash, Ghost, Heal!

I don't claim that everybody can be successful with Blitzcrank jungling, but if you try a bit, you can pull some pretty sick stuff with the Big Golem. If you find yourself being constantly counter-jungled and losing xp, focus more on ganking (stealing some xp from lanes in the process) and ward vital spots of your jungle with a Sight Ward, so as to catch and maybe kill the invader.
Always ask your team's help if you are getting invaded and counter-jungled by a stronger Jungler. Warding dragon and baron should be a priority for you and be sure to save Smite when their time comes.

Closing, always remember, AFK jungling is not in your favor, because ganking is where Blitz excels, not jungle farming. If you are new to jungle or just need more information about jungling, please visit a more detail general jungle guide. It will help you a lot to understand what is what.

Gameplay and general tips

SPACE
  • Always remember to warn your allies in time for your gank, so as to coordinate and be more successful.
  • You can Rocket Grab blue buff at the side of the wall on its back and kill it there without it resetting.(useful for enemy blue steal)
  • While advancing towards an opponent who is aware of your presence and tries to avoid your Rocket Grab, delay it and/or try to Power Fist him instead, especially if his "avoiding" path prevents him from running straight the hell out.
  • Try to be patient and use Rocket Grab at the proper moment when you "feel" you can predict your opponent's movement.
  • Use your Static Field after you have executed a successful Rocket Grab and Power Fist and don't just save it for the end to take the kill. Generally avoid "kill-stealing", it's bad for team spirit.
  • If you know a certain enemy champion doesn't have a summoner spell ready like Flash, don't hesitate to Flash in for a Power Fist. Flash can be used offensively, especially if you know you can secure a kill.(easy with Blitz + allies)
  • If you are jungling, always remember to put more pressure to a lane where your allies are losing or doing bad. Even if it's warded and the opponents can see you, you do good by showing your presence at your allies side, holding back their advance and make them lose some cs.
  • If a Sight Ward stops you from ganking a certain lane continuously, try to find a different route to that lane. For example, use the side brass when your team has pushed a bit on top or bot. If you feel safe enough, go through the enemy jungle, above baron or dragon, to get to a lane unseen from river wards.
  • If you feel confident enough, buy an Oracle's Elixir early on.

All these apply not only to Jungling Blitzcrank, but to all roles, because Blitzcrank is generally good at ganking. Even if you Support, you can pretend you go ward the river and make a quick gank mid. Same applies for top as AD or AP.
